QA Engineer II

QA, Engineer, Computer, SQL, Performance, Automated, Telecommunications, Artificial Intelligence, Foundation
Full Time

Job Description

QA Engineer II
Location: Salt Lake City, UT

The QA Engineer II is responsible for evaluating the overall quality of our products by developing test plans and scripts to validate product functionality and performance. As an integral contributor to our Agile development teams, the QA Engineer II designs and executes both manual and automated test cases to ensure the highest level of quality and timely deliveries to the NICE inContact platform. Throughout the project lifecycle this individual will clearly outline the current state of the product and project by communicating any and all risks to the team.

As a QA Engineer II, a Typical Day Might Include the Following:
  • Be passionate about quality and driven to accomplish the company's goals.
  • Develop and execute a complete test strategy for assigned products and features including verification of functional, performance, security and scalability requirements
  • Design, extend, optimize and execute test plans and test cases based on business requirements and functional specifications.
  • Communicate QA results, risks and project status to management team as well as other stake holders
  • Follow and execute on team-specified "done" criteria for testing features
  • Continuously streamline and improve the testing life cycle to ensure test planning, execution, and reporting are effective, agile, and coordinated
  • Interact closely with developers offering suggestions and ideas for improving the quality of products
  • Analyze testing results to enhance future test plans and scenarios. (Including metrics and benchmarks to gauge improvement)
  • Pro-active investigation/verification of production defects and continuous improvement of regression tests
  • Create automated testing scripts as required
  • Create QA tasks and monitor individual burn-downs to ensure completion
  • Identify log, track and report bugs to QA management and development team
  • Become a subject matter expert with NICE inContact product(s)

To Land This Gig You'll Need:
  • BS in Computer Science, or equivalent work experience
  • Knowledge of QA practices and policies
  • 3-5 years of experience in software testing and quality assurance
  • Experience with testing tools
  • Experience writing SQL statements
  • Ability to script automated tests
  • Thorough understanding of the following types of testing: Functional, Usability, Load, Stress, Integration, Data validation, Performance, Automated testing and Regression
  • Possess strong communication & decision making skills

Bonus Experience:
  • Experience with Telecommunications
  • Experience with VoIP Technology
  • Ability to work independently and self-manage projects
  • 2+ year programming or scripting experience
  • DevOps experience
  • CI/CD experience
  • Experience with call server technologies
  • Cloud experience, AWS preferred

ABOUT NICE inContact: NICE inContact makes it easy and affordable for organizations around the globe to provide exceptional customer experiences while meeting key business metrics. NICE inContact provides the world's No. 1 cloud customer experience platform, NICE inContact CXone™, combining best-in-class Omnichannel Routing, Workforce Optimization, Analytics, Automation and Artificial Intelligence on an Open Cloud Foundation. NICE inContact is a part of NICE (Nasdaq: NICE), the worldwide leading provider of both cloud and on-premises enterprise software solutions.
Dice Id : 10115980
Position Id : oBLqdfwJ
Originally Posted : 2 weeks ago
Have a Job? Post it

Similar Positions

Senior QA Engineer / Lead
  • Edgelink
  • Salt Lake City, UT
QA Automated Analyst
  • Quantix Consulting
  • Lehi, UT
Sr. Test Automation Engineer
  • Rose IT Corp.
  • American Fork, UT
Software Quality Analyst
  • Eliassen Group
  • American Fork, UT
QA Engineer
  • Software Technology Group
  • Salt Lake City, UT
GBSD Software Quality Assurance Engineer
  • Northrop Grumman
  • Roy, UT
Senior Software Development Engineer in Test
  • Apex Systems
  • Salt Lake City, UT
REMOTE OTT Lead Quality Engineer
  • Conch Technologies
  • American Fork, Ut, UT
Software Load/Performance Testing Engineer
  • Javen Technologies, Inc
  • Taylorsville, UT
Software Engineer, Java
  • Micro Focus LLC
  • Provo, UT
QA Engineer
  • SNI Technology
  • Broomfield, CO
QA Tester
  • Volt Services Group
  • Golden, CO
WMS QA Analyst
  • Rezult Group, Inc
  • Denver, CO